    I think I would move the boy in with me as well.;) I think it's heartbreaking that at 16 they are kicked out of the system. Is it worth talking to Social Services to see if you could come to an arrangement with him living with you as an older foster child? i.e. they pay you money to feed, clothe and house him. Many SS in LA have a leaving care programme and they might have funding available to help the boy.
